Description Leadership Development Program: Launch Your Management Career Budget's 16-month accelerated leadership program is designed to fast-track ambitious recent college graduates into senior management and executive roles at the nation's largest and most successful rental car franchise. As a selected participant, you'll be based in one of our dynamic locations across seven key cities in the Southeast, Midwest, or Mountain West regions—offering the perfect blend of professional growth and vibrant lifestyle opportunities. We're seeking highly motivated, ambitious, and entrepreneurial individuals ready to dive in and make an impact. You'll receive a comprehensive, personalized development plan with hands-on rotations across all departments, providing invaluable firsthand insight into our end-to-end operations. This forward-thinking program is built to rapidly build the strategic knowledge, leadership skills, and business acumen essential for critical senior management and executive positions. It's a rare chance to "earn your stripes from the ground up" in an intensive, condensed timeframe—gaining real-world experience that sets you apart in the industry. Highlights include frontline operations immersion, plus exclusive travel to Salt Lake City, UT, and our corporate headquarters in Atlanta, GA, where you'll collaborate directly with our executive team on high-level strategy and leadership training. Key Rotations and Responsibilities Gain diverse, practical experience across core functions: - Logistics: Track and optimize vehicle fleet movements based on demand forecasting; deliver exceptional customer assistance and coordinate seamless roadside support. - Revenue Management: Leverage data analytics to predict customer demand, dynamically adjust pricing strategies, and drive revenue growth. - Vehicle Maintenance, Repair & Remarketing: Conduct thorough damage assessments, manage vendor partnerships for repairs, and prepare vehicles for high-value remarketing. - **Operations & Asset Control**: Elevate the customer experience through frontline transactions; expertly upsell products and services to boost sales; perform professional vehicle detailing; resolve customer issues with empathy and efficiency; and oversee inventory controls and asset management processes. - Recruiting & Talent Acquisition: Source top talent, review applications, and represent the company at campus events and career fairs to build our future team. - Administration & Human Resources: Partner with executives on strategic initiatives while supporting key departments, including HR, accounting, claims, fleet management, and training & development.
